Around Happy Acres ...

The largest community within a 50 mile [80 km] radius is Greenville (SC). It is located about 26 miles [41 km] to the southeast of Happy Acres. Greenville (SC) has a population of 72,200 people.<1>.

The next largest community is Greer (SC). It is located about 30 miles [ km] to the southeast of Happy Acres and has a population of 35,300 people.

Transylvania County ...

Happy Acres is located in Transylvania County<4>.

The following counties adjoin and form the boundaries of Transylvania County: Haywood, Henderson, Jackson, Greenville (SC), Oconee (SC) & Pickens (SC).
